Transaction 17f305bfc9813900a7a38212f1eea7d1519b3e2930eaf73cdd876501f1047655
1 Input
1 Output
-
17f305bfc9813900a7a38212f1eea7d1519b3e2930eaf73cdd876501f1047655:0
- value
- 7201428
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7a487c017e4c49046e26e584a55874db3a3e847
- address
- bc1q77jg0sqhunzfq3hzdevy54v8fke686z82ckdm6